Quick Reference Specifications

SpecificationValuePage
Rear wheel nut torque145~165 ft. lbs. (196~226N・m, 20~23 kgf·m)p. 34
Fuel filter replacement intervalEvery 400 hoursp. 37
Hydraulic mechanism oil filter cleaning interval (initial)After the first 35 hours of usep. 36
Oil pressure filter cleaning interval (subsequent)Every 200 hoursp. 37
Air cleaner element cleaning intervalEvery 100 hoursp. 37
Air cleaner element replacement intervalAfter one year's use (every 6 cleaning)p. 37
Fan belt play/tension9/32 in. (7mm) play in tension. 13/16~2 in. (20~50mm) at outer circum-ference.p. 37
Engine Total Displacement68.3 Cu. in. (1115cm³)p. 7
Engine Rated Revolution2800 rpm (46.7r/s)p. 7
Fuel Tank Capacity5.8 Gallons (22ℓ)p. 7
Cooling System Capacity7.0 Quarts (6.6ℓ)p. 7
Engine Crankcase Oil Capacity6.4 Quarts (6.1ℓ)p. 7

Kubota L245, L245DT Common Problems This Manual Covers

Kubota L245 engine won't start after fuel filter replacement, cranks but no fire p. 29

Bleed air from the fuel system before cranking. Loosen the bleed screw on the fuel filter housing, let fuel flow until no bubbles appear, then tighten. Open the bleed screw on the injection pump next and repeat. Check that the fuel tank has at least 1 gallon in it; the 5.8-gallon (22L) tank can read deceptively low on a slope. Refer to starting procedure on page 14 and troubleshooting on page 29.

Manual Section: Engine Starting Issues
Hydraulic lift raises slowly or won't hold implement at full height p. 19

Check hydraulic fluid level first. The transmission shares hydraulic fluid; capacity is 23 qts. (22L) on the L245 or 24 qts. (23L) on the L245DT. Top off with the correct grade if low. Then inspect the hydraulic suction screen: clean it after the first 35 hours, then every 200 hours. Review the hydraulic system overview on page 19 for level check and filter locations.

Manual Section: Hydraulic System
Temperature warning light stays on or radiator boiling over during field work p. 29

Stop immediately and let the engine idle two minutes before shutdown; never open a hot radiator cap. Check coolant level when cool: capacity is 7.0 quarts (6.6L). Clean the radiator screen and grill fins of chaff and debris; blocked airflow is the most common cause on row-crop work. Verify fan belt deflection: correct play is 9/32 in. (7mm) measured mid-span. Troubleshooting steps are on page 29, cooling system checks on page 23.

Manual Section: Cooling System Overheating
Oil pressure warning lamp stays on at idle after engine reaches operating temperature p. 9

Shut the engine off within 30 seconds: an illuminated oil lamp at idle is not a sensor glitch. Check engine crankcase oil level on the dipstick; capacity is 6.4 quarts (6.1L). Change interval is every 75 hours after the initial 35-hour break-in change. If oil level is correct and the lamp stays on after restart, do not continue operating. See indicator light descriptions starting on page 9 and troubleshooting on page 29.

Manual Section: Electrical System Indicator Issues
Engine blows dark black exhaust under load, power feels flat p. 31

Pull the air cleaner element first: a choked filter is the fastest route to rich, black smoke. Clean it every 100 hours; replace it after one year or every sixth cleaning, whichever comes first. Tap the element gently to dislodge loose dust; never wash with water or blow from outside in. If smoke continues after a fresh element, check fuel quality and refer to exhaust diagnosis on page 31.

Manual Section: Exhaust Gas Color Diagnosis
Tractor hard to start in cold mornings, glow plugs not warming cab p. 29

Allow the full glow plug preheat cycle before cranking: turn the key to preheat and wait for the indicator to signal ready before engaging the starter. Check battery terminals for corrosion; a weak battery at low temperature drops too much voltage for the glow system to reach proper temperature. Battery and starter diagnostics are on page 29. For repeated cold-start difficulty, inspect the glow plug wiring on the diagram on page 35.

Manual Section: Battery & Starter Issues

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the torque specs for Kubota L245DT wheel nuts?

After changing the rear wheel tread, torque the wheel nuts on the Kubota L245DT to 145~165 ft. lbs. (196~226N・m, 20~23 kgf·m). Use these figures any time you adjust the tread.

How often should I service the air cleaner and fuel filter on the Kubota L245?

The maintenance schedule calls for cleaning the air cleaner element every 100 hours and replacing it after one year's use or every sixth cleaning, whichever comes first (page 37). The fuel filter should be replaced every 400 hours (page 37). The manual's maintenance check list lays out these intervals so you can keep the tractor on schedule.

What are the fluid capacities for the Kubota L245 — fuel, coolant, and engine oil?

Per the specifications, the fuel tank holds 5.8 gallons (22L), the cooling system holds 7.0 quarts (6.6L), and the engine crankcase oil capacity is 6.4 quarts (6.1L) (page 7). Having these figures on hand makes refills and oil changes straightforward without guessing.

My Kubota L245 cranks but won't start after I changed the fuel filter — how do I fix it?

Air trapped in the fuel system after a filter change is the usual cause. Loosen the bleed screw on the fuel filter housing and let fuel flow until no bubbles appear, then tighten it; repeat at the injection pump bleed screw. Also confirm the tank has fuel, since the 5.8-gallon (22L) tank can read low on a slope. The starting procedure is on page 14 and troubleshooting is on page 29.

How do I check and adjust the fan belt tension on the Kubota L245?

Correct fan belt play is 9/32 in. (7mm) measured mid-span, with 13/16~2 in. (20~50mm) deflection at the outer circumference (page 37). A loose or worn belt is also worth checking if the temperature warning light comes on, since proper belt tension keeps the water pump and fan turning to prevent overheating (page 29).
